Moral Hazard
The risk that one party to a transaction has not entered into the contract in good faith, or has an incentive to take unusual risks in a bid to earn a profit before the contract settles.

Monitoring
The act of overseeing or checking on the progress or quality of a project, process, or performance of employees systematically.
